Who needs securities and exchange commission?
01
Various individuals and entities may need to interact with the Securities and Exchange Commission, including:
02
- Publicly traded companies: Companies that are listed on stock exchanges or planning to go public need to comply with the securities regulations enforced by the Securities and Exchange Commission.
03
- Investors: Individual investors, institutional investors, and investment firms rely on the Securities and Exchange Commission to ensure fair and transparent markets, protect investors' interests, and provide relevant information for making informed investment decisions.
04
- Securities professionals: Individuals working in the securities industry, such as brokers, dealers, and investment advisers, need to be registered with or regulated by the Securities and Exchange Commission.
05
- Market participants: Other participants in the financial markets, including stock exchanges, clearing agencies, transfer agents, and self-regulatory organizations, may need to interact with the Securities and Exchange Commission to comply with regulatory requirements.
06
- Legal and financial professionals: Lawyers, accountants, and other professionals involved in securities offerings, mergers and acquisitions, and other transactions involving securities may need to consult the Securities and Exchange Commission guidelines and regulations.

What is securities and exchange commission?
The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) is a regulatory agency that oversees the securities industry and enforces federal securities laws.
Who is required to file securities and exchange commission?
Companies that are publicly traded or that meet certain criteria set by the SEC are required to file with the Securities and Exchange Commission.
How to fill out securities and exchange commission?
Companies can fill out and submit forms electronically through the SEC's EDGAR system.
What is the purpose of securities and exchange commission?
The purpose of the SEC is to protect investors, maintain fair and efficient markets, and facilitate capital formation.
What information must be reported on securities and exchange commission?
Companies must provide detailed financial information, disclosures about their business operations, and other relevant information to the SEC.
